History:

The Columbia County Traveling Library was founded in 1941, through the combined efforts of the Bloomsburg Public Library, county school officials, and the Columbia County Commissioners. The Bloomsburg Public Library was asked to administer and house the bookmobile and its collection, and the county provided financial support via an annual appropriation. The first bookmobile arrived July 21, 1941, made its debut at the Benton farmer’s picnic, and began a schedule of stops to country schools and communities under the direction of the first librarian, Ruth Beers. The Traveling Library has operated a program of outreach service continuously ever since its inception.

In 1988 a separate board of directors was established to comply with state requirements. In 1997, the library was organized as a county authority, and moved from the Bloomsburg Public Library to the county office building at 15 Perry Avenue, Bloomsburg.

Board of Directors:

Board members serve for a 3 year term, represent most geographic areas of Columbia County, and are appointed by the Columbia County Commissioners.
